What should I see and do in Gaisbach?
Explore the area and family-friendly sights such as Wildpark Bad Mergentheim, or get out into nature at a spot like Jagst Badeplatz Kloster Schöntal. Langenburg Castle and Car Museum and Hohenlohe Open-Air Museum are a couple of places you’ll find in the larger area.
What is an aparthotel?
An aparthotel or serviced apartment offers privacy and space found in an apartment and amenities you might expect at a traditional hotel.
